Cauliflower Fried Rice

1 serving of cauliflower fried rice contains 129 Calories. The macronutrient breakdown is 42% carbs, 34% fat, and 24% protein. This is a good source of protein (15% of your Daily Value), fiber (17% of your Daily Value), and potassium (14% of your Daily Value).

Directions
- Rinse and chop the cauliflower into florets and put into a food processor. (If you don't have a food processor continue to chop the cauliflower into tiny pieces or use a box grater.) Pulse until the cauliflower until it is small and resembles rice.
- Defrost peas and carrots according to package directions in microwave and drain if needed. Preheat a large skillet or wok to medium heat. Pour sesame oil in the bottom. Chop the onions and add along with peas and carrots and fry until tender.
- Slide the onion, peas and carrots to the side, and pour the beaten eggs onto the other side. Using a spatula, scramble the eggs. Once cooked, mix the eggs with the vegetable mix.
- Add the cauliflower to the veggie and egg mixture. Pour the soy sauce on top. Stir and fry the rice and veggie mixture until heated through and cauliflower is tender. Add chopped green onions if desired. Enjoy!
